Last weekend the third instalment of Hoodstock tore its way through the Colour Factory, bringing a mix of exciting artists along with a “DIY ethos and straight fuck-off attitude” to fans in the capital.
The brainchild of Fuzzbrain Music and rising star Deijuvhs (who was also playing on the day), the hardcore, metal and rap London fest not only showed just what a great place the alternative scene is in right now, it also crucially raises money for the Hoodstock Fund – which was established to help young people find their way in music through offsetting studio and gig costs.
Featuring the likes of Chubby And The Gang, SINN6R, Nailbreaker, FelixThe1st and of course Deijuvhs, this is what Hoodstock 2023 looked like…
